How it works
Every person in a room bends and scatters WiFi waves a little. More people means more disturbance, so the system can count heads and see which corners are crowded. Nobody is photographed or identified.
In the physics: Each additional person adds independent reflectors and scattering paths that measurably raise multipath richness and RTI cell occupancy; the aggregate change scales monotonically with count, and dwell shows as persistent occupancy in specific zones.
